1. The Grandeur of Ataturk Mausoleum: A Tribute to a Nation’s Hero 🇹🇷
Start your Ankara adventure at the Ataturk Mausoleum, also known as Anıtkabir. This majestic monument is dedicated to Mustafa Kemal Atatürk, the founder and first president of the Republic of Turkey. The grandiose structure, surrounded by beautifully landscaped gardens, is a testament to the nation’s respect for its leader. 🏛️
Tip: Visit early in the morning to avoid the crowds and catch the changing of the guard ceremony, which is a sight to behold. 🕰️
2. Exploring the Ancient Ruins of Phrygian Valley 🏞️
A short drive from Ankara, the Phrygian Valley offers a glimpse into Turkey’s ancient past. This region is dotted with rock-cut tombs, temples, and mysterious stone formations that date back to the Phrygian civilization. It’s like stepping into a real-life Indiana Jones movie set. 🏟️
Fun fact: The most famous site in the Phrygian Valley is the Midas City, where legend has it that King Midas once lived. 🍁

4. The Historical Marvels of Ankara Castle: A Walk Through Time 🏰
No visit to Ankara is complete without exploring the historic Ankara Castle. Perched on a hill, this medieval fortress offers panoramic views of the city and is home to several well-preserved structures, including the Temple of Augustus and Rome. 🏺
Pro tip: Climb to the top of the castle for a breathtaking sunset view over the city. 🌅
